Afghan migrant guilty of threatening to kill Nigel Farage

An Afghan migrant has been convicted of threatening to kill Nigel Farage.

Fayaz Khan threatened to shoot the Reform UK leader in a TikTok video after Farage criticised his plan to illegally cross the Channel in a small boat, Southwark crown court was told. He had previously been jailed in Sweden for saying that he would stab and rape a woman.

Taliban sells £40 fake death threats for asylum seekers to UK

Fake death threat letters from the Taliban are being used to dupe the Home Office in asylum applications for Afghan migrants.

A Telegraph investigation can reveal how corrupt officials in Afghanistan produce government letters threatening to kill asylum seekers. The letters are then used as evidence in asylum applications.

To demonstrate how easily such documents can be obtained, an undercover Telegraph reporter paid Taliban officials £40 to produce three fake letters from different regional offices on official headed paper, signed by local administrators.

Giorgia Meloni proposes burka ban with fines of £2,600 to stop ‘Islamic separatism’

Giorgia Meloni has called for a burka and niqab ban in public places in Italy with fines of £2,600 to stop ‘Islamic separatism’.

The bill, presented to parliament by the Italian prime minister’s Brothers of Italy party on Wednesday, would see those wearing the garment in shops, offices, schools and universities fined between £260 and £2,600.

It will also introduce criminal penalties for ‘cultural crimes’ including virginity testing and increase punishments for forced marriages to up to 10 years in prison, with religious coercion grounds for prosecution.

Islamist terror suspects ‘plotted mass shooting of Jews’

Two alleged Islamic State-inspired terrorists plotted to massacre Jews in the North West, a court has heard.

Walid Saadaoui, 38, and Amar Hussein, 52, planned to “kill as many members of the Jewish community as they could” with assault rifles similar to those used in the 2015 Paris terror attacks, Preston Crown Court was told.

Jurors were told the pair hoped to become “martyrs” after causing “untold harm” by planning “mass fatalities”.

Jihad Al-Shamie pledged allegiance to ‘ISIS’ in 999 call

The man who carried out the Manchester synagogue attack made a 999 call in which he pledged allegiance to the group calling itself Islamic State.

Jihad Al-Shamie, 35, was shot dead by police outside the Heaton Park Hebrew Congregation synagogue after a car and knife attack that saw two Jewish men killed.

The call was made after Al-Shamie’s car hit a wall after he drove into worshippers, a spokesperson for Counter Terrorism Police North West confirmed.

Canadian families of Oct. 7 victims criticize Carney for not meeting them since becoming PM

The Canadian families of eight victims of the Hamas-led Oct. 7 attack on Israel have written to Prime Minister Mark Carney, criticizing him for not reaching out to them since taking office, and asking him for a meeting.

Their letter to the Prime Minister noted that other world leaders have held several meetings with families of victims in the two years since the attack.
